Catilas Resources Limited is looking for an experienced Chief Operating Officer with proven experience in Maritime, Oil & Gas (downstream and upstream) industry to oversee our client's organization ongoing operations and procedures for the efficiency of business.


The COO role is a key member of the senior management team, reporting only to the Chief Executive Officer (CEO). You’ll have to maintain control of diverse business operations, so we expect you to be an experienced and efficient leader. If you also have excellent people skills, business acumen and exemplary work ethics, we'd like to meet you.

Role Objective
The goal of the COO position is to secure the functionality of business to drive extensive and sustainable growth.

Responsibilities

  • Write and submit reports to the CEO in all matters of importance
  • Assist CEO in fundraising ventures
  • Design and implement business strategies, plans and procedures
  • Set comprehensive goals for performance and growth
  • Establish policies that promote company culture and vision
  • Oversee daily operations of the company and the work of executives (IT, Marketing, Sales, Finance etc.)
  • Lead employees to encourage maximum performance and dedication
  • Evaluate performance by analyzing and interpreting data and metrics
  • Participate in expansion activities (investments, acquisitions, corporate alliances etc.)
  • Manage relationships with partners/vendors
